Linux系统重启服务命令

Linux系统重启服务命令

  • 1. reboot
    • 这是最常用的重启命令,执行reboot命令后系统将会重新启动。该命令需要管理员权限才能执行。
  • 2. shutdown
    • 该命令比reboot更加智能,它允许管理员设置重启的时间,同时还可以对系统进行一些操作,如向所有用户发送警告信息、关闭所有应用程序等。
    • 常见用法有:
      • shutdown -h now 立即关机
      • shutdown -r now 立即重启
      • shutdown -r 10 过10分钟重启
      • shutdown -r 20:00 在晚上8点重启
  • 3. init
    • init命令是Linux系统中的一个重要进程,它负责启动所有其他进程。在重启之前,init将清除所有缓存,并结束当前所有正在执行的进程。因此,使用该命令会比较慢。
    • init 6 立即重启
  • 4. systemctl
    • systemctl是systemd服务管理工具的一部分,可用于启动、停止、重启、检查系统服务状态等。因为很多Linux发行版已经实现了systemd,所以使用systemctl命令也变得越来越普遍。
    • systemctl reboot 立即重启

关注公众号:有点建树,做更多交流。
在这里插入图片描述

<think>好的,用户想了解在Linux系统重启服务器命令。我需要根据提供的引用内容来整理答案。首先,引用1提到了shutdown命令,特别是sudo shutdown -r now。引用3详细列出了shutdown、reboot、init、halt和poweroff这些命令,并说明了它们的区别。引用4补充了shutdown命令的定时重启和通知功能。引用2则建议优先使用reboot或shutdown,因为它们更安全可靠,而init或systemctl在系统无响应时使用,组合键作为最后手段。 用户的需求是查找重启命令,所以需要把常用的方法列出来。首先要推荐最安全的方式,也就是shutdown和reboot。然后介绍其他方法,比如init 6和systemctl reboot,同时说明它们的使用场景,比如系统无响应时。最后提到紧急情况下的组合键Ctrl+Alt+Del,但强调这是最后的选择。 要确保结构清晰,分点说明每个命令的用法和适用情况。同时注意引用对应的来源,比如在介绍shutdown时引用3和4,reboot引用3和2,其他方法引用2和3。可能还需要注意语法正确,比如命令的参数和示例是否正确。 最后,生成相关问题时要围绕重启命令的不同情况、区别、系统无响应时的处理,以及如何定时重启。确保问题覆盖用户可能关心的其他方面。</think>在Linux系统重启服务器的常用命令及适用场景如下: ### 一、标准重启方式 1. **shutdown命令**(最安全) ```bash sudo shutdown -r now # 立即重启[^3][^4] sudo shutdown -r +10 "系统将在10分钟后重启" # 定时重启并发送通知[^3][^4] ``` 支持定时功能,会正常终止进程并同步磁盘数据[^3] 2. **reboot命令**(推荐使用) ```bash sudo reboot # 等同于 shutdown -r now[^3] ``` 直接触发重启流程,适用于常规重启需求[^2] ### 二、备用重启方式 3. **init命令** ```bash sudo init 6 # 切换到运行级别6触发重启[^3] ``` 通过修改系统运行级别实现重启,属于传统SysV初始化方式[^3] 4. **systemctl命令**(适用于systemd系统) ```bash sudo systemctl reboot # 现代Linux发行版推荐方式[^2] ``` ### 三、紧急情况处理 5. **物理组合键** ```bash Ctrl + Alt + Del # 最后手段,可能丢失数据[^2] 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值